摘要

Abstract

The mixture ratio of lightweight energy-saving unburned brick with large mixed fly ash was studied that fly ash as raw materials, adding the partial ceramisite agitator, expanded perlite, sand, rock powder to make the aggregate, and being mixed with few calcareous materials and the micro excitant. We have controlled the product quality by selecting raw materials and mixture ratio, setting technique of production. Its apparent density in 1700-1900 kg/m3 , strength grade of not less than MU10, and other qualification have reached JC 2392-2001. Finally we have discussed its enhancement mechanism simply.
